# Continuity Governance **Entity class:** Concept or analytic term ## Definition Continuity governance is the institutional architecture for deciding how a person-like computational process may be acquired, instantiated, hosted, repaired, migrated, copied, merged, retired and represented. ## Scope It joins technical integrity to rights, custody, infrastructure, provenance and due process. It must separate the power to host a continuant from authority to alter or speak for that continuant. ## See Also [[wiki/Continuity Due Process|Continuity Due Process]], [[wiki/Continuity Citizenship|Continuity Citizenship]], [[wiki/Runtime Coherence|Runtime Coherence]], [[wiki/Continuity Contract|Continuity Contract]] ## Relationships <!-- BEGIN HUMANIZED RELATIONSHIPS 2026-09-11 --> This entry is routed through [[collections/Consciousness Continuity|Consciousness Continuity]], [[collections/Neurotech|Neurotech]], and [[collections/Machine Succession|Machine Succession]]. Collection route: [[collections/Neurotech|Neurotech]]. ### Standards, formats, custody, and rights - **INF-0251 — Established.** NWB gives neurophysiology a common container with self-describing metadata, which makes data from different labs and devices mutually readable. Every cross-institution model of neural activity depends on that container existing, and it was built by a small community with modest funding. - **Attractor routes:** [[wiki/Neurodata Without Borders|Neurodata Without Borders]] · [[wiki/NWB|NWB]] - **INF-0252 — Established.** A public archive with required standard formatting converts scattered experiments into a training corpus. The archive, not any single laboratory, is the asset, and its governance determines who can build foundation models on human neural data. - **Attractor routes:** [[wiki/DANDI Archive|DANDI Archive]] · [[wiki/Neurodata Without Borders|Neurodata Without Borders]] - **INF-0253 — Established.** BIDS standardized how neuroimaging datasets are laid out on disk, and adoption spread because it made tooling composable rather than because it was mandated. Voluntary structural conventions outperform imposed schemas, which is the relevant lesson for continuity formats. - **Attractor routes:** [[wiki/BIDS|BIDS]] · [[wiki/Neurodata Without Borders|Neurodata Without Borders]] - **INF-0254 — Analytic.** DICOM shows that a format designed for interchange becomes infrastructure and survives every vendor that implements it. Neural interface data will need its clinical-grade equivalent, and whoever authors it inherits decades of default authority. - **Attractor routes:** [[wiki/DICOM|DICOM]] · [[wiki/Neural Data Provenance|Neural Data Provenance]] - **INF-0255 — Strongly indicated.** Standardization is what makes neural data trainable at scale, so format work is the upstream determinant of model capability. The unglamorous committee output governs the eventual decoding ceiling more than any device improvement. - **Attractor routes:** [[wiki/AI-Ready Neurodata|AI-Ready Neurodata]] · [[wiki/Neurodata Without Borders|Neurodata Without Borders]] - **INF-0256 — Analytic.** Recording acquisition device, subject state, preprocessing, and software version alongside the data is what allows a result to be re-derived later. In a continuity context that same metadata is the difference between a person's record and an unattributable file. - **Attractor routes:** [[wiki/Provenance|Provenance]] · [[wiki/Neural Data Provenance|Neural Data Provenance]] - **INF-0257 — Strongly indicated.** Cell-type atlases require agreed names before comparisons across laboratories mean anything, which is why nomenclature committees precede discoveries in practice. Shared ontology is the substrate on which comparative connectomics and typed emulation both depend. - **Attractor routes:** [[wiki/Ontology|Ontology]] · [[wiki/Conformance Testing|Conformance Testing]] - **INF-0258 — Established.** A common coordinate framework lets any measurement be registered to a shared anatomical space, making independent datasets additive. Coordinate frameworks are the quiet infrastructure that turns a field's output from a pile into a corpus. - **Attractor routes:** [[wiki/Neuroinformatics Standards|Neuroinformatics Standards]] · [[wiki/DICOM|DICOM]] - **INF-0259 — Plausible.** If clinical BCIs write a common format, a patient's decoder history survives a change of device vendor. Device-neutral records are the patient-side equivalent of the portability fight, and they are decided in standards bodies years before anyone notices. - **Attractor routes:** [[wiki/Portability|Portability]] · [[wiki/DICOM|DICOM]] - **INF-0260 — Plausible.** Neural telemetry entering the electronic health record through existing health-data standards makes it subject to the entire apparatus of medical records law. Integration path determines legal regime, which makes an engineering choice into a rights question. - **Attractor routes:** [[wiki/Neural Data Provenance|Neural Data Provenance]] · [[wiki/DICOM|DICOM]] - **INF-0261 — Strongly indicated.** International standards for neurotechnology data and privacy are being drafted by committees whose membership is public and whose national delegations are traceable. Standards authorship is the most legible form of long-range influence available, and it is being exercised now. - **Attractor routes:** [[wiki/Neuroinformatics Standards|Neuroinformatics Standards]] · [[wiki/Neurodata Without Borders|Neurodata Without Borders]] - **INF-0262 — Analytic.** Connectomics, neurophysiology, and imaging all advanced fastest where tooling was open and shared. Openness functions as a compounding accelerant, and the fields that closed their tooling are measurably slower. - **Attractor routes:** [[wiki/Neurodata Without Borders|Neurodata Without Borders]] · [[wiki/Serialization|Serialization]] - **INF-0263 — Strongly indicated.** Capability domains accelerate once a benchmark exists because improvement becomes visible and comparable. In a continuity market, conformance testing would decide which hosts are allowed to receive a person, which is regulatory power exercised through tooling. - **Attractor routes:** [[wiki/Conformance Testing|Conformance Testing]] · [[wiki/Serialization|Serialization]] - **INF-0276 — Established.** California classifies neural data as sensitive personal information with an opt-out right, and uniquely reaches employee data as well as consumer data. Employment coverage is the provision with the widest practical effect, because the workplace is where non-consensual neural monitoring is most likely to be normalized. - **Attractor routes:** [[wiki/Mental Privacy|Mental Privacy]] · [[wiki/Neurorights|Neurorights]] - **INF-0277 — Established.** Colorado placed neural data inside a broader "biological data" category requiring consent, taking a consent-first rather than opt-out approach. Two adjacent states chose opposite default rules in the same year, which guarantees a harmonization fight and a federal preemption argument. - **Attractor routes:** [[wiki/Neurorights|Neurorights]] · [[wiki/Continuity Contract|Continuity Contract]] - **INF-0278 — Established.** Connecticut's neural-data amendment took effect 1 July 2026, extending consent requirements to central nervous system measurements. Each additional state raises compliance cost for a national product, and compliance cost is what eventually produces a federal standard. - **Attractor routes:** [[wiki/Mental Privacy|Mental Privacy]] · [[wiki/Neurorights|Neurorights]] - **INF-0279 — Established.** The MIND Act would direct the FTC to study neural data and recommend a framework, and it has not advanced beyond committee. A study mandate is the legislative form of deferral, and deferral at the federal level cedes the field to state law and to industry practice. - **Attractor routes:** [[wiki/Continuity Contract|Continuity Contract]] · [[wiki/Ring Zero|Ring Zero]] - **INF-0280 — Established.** Adoption by all 194 member states in November 2025 created the first global normative framework for neurotechnology, establishing cognitive liberty, mental privacy, and equitable access as principles. Non-binding instruments of this kind reliably propagate into domestic legislation within a decade. - **Attractor routes:** [[wiki/UNESCO Recommendation on the Ethics of Neurotechnology|UNESCO Recommendation on the Ethics of Neurotechnology]] · [[wiki/Cognitive Liberty|Cognitive Liberty]] - **INF-0281 — Established.** Chile amended its constitution in 2021 to protect neurorights and its Supreme Court has applied those provisions against a consumer neurotechnology company. A constitutional neurorights provision has therefore been tested in court, which makes it precedent rather than aspiration. - **Attractor routes:** [[wiki/Neurorights|Neurorights]] · [[wiki/Cognitive Liberty|Cognitive Liberty]] - **INF-0282 — Analytic.** California's definition excludes data inferred from non-neural sources, which leaves behavioral inference of mental state entirely unregulated by the neural-data provisions. Every commercial system that wants mental-state information will be built on the permitted side of that line. - **Attractor routes:** [[wiki/Mental Privacy|Mental Privacy]] · [[wiki/Neurorights|Neurorights]] - **INF-0283 — Established.** France and Germany are drafting prohibitions on mandatory neurotechnology in employment contracts, which identifies the workplace as the recognized pressure point.
